American Copier Solutions
Office supplies
0.0(0 Reviews)
2651 Saint Clair Ave NE, 44114 Cleveland
Industries / Specializations
Office suppliesMap
2651 Saint Clair Ave NE, 44114 Cleveland
Reviews
Unverified Reviews0.0
(0 Reviews)
Office supplies
2651 Saint Clair Ave NE, 44114 Cleveland
Heating construction · renovation
2604 Saint Clair Ave NE, 44114 Cleveland